Sara Elizabeth Greene & Joseph Max Domo

Sara Greene and Joseph Domo met as freshman at Wake Forest University. They were married by Reverend Timothy O’Brien in an intimate ceremony at St. Aloysius Church in New Canaan, where the bride grew up. The couple renewed their vows the next day in front of family and friends at Blue Hill at Stone Barns in Tarrytown, New York. The bride, daughter of Michael and Betsy Greene of New Canaan, wore her mother’s veil to the church ceremony and her bouquet was wrapped in her christening bonnet, which is an Irish tradition. The groom is the son of James and Mary Kay Domo of Chagrin Falls, Ohio.
